Our Company
Cyprotex vision is to be pioneers of innovative ADME-Tox partnerships, driving delivery of safer and more effective medicines. With state-of-the-art facilities and technical expertise, we specialise in in vitro and in silico ADME-Tox services, providing a wide range of assays tailored to our client’s needs. This includes in vitro screening to support discovery projects, regulatory studies to support preclinical and clinical development, specialist mechanistic in vitro human and animal toxicity models and PBPK/QSAR modelling expertise. As well as supporting clients directly, we have a strong focus on efficiencies and innovation.
Our Alderley Park site is set in the heart of Cheshire surrounded by 400-acre estate, open green spaces, and easy access to public transport. Cyprotex is part of the Evotec Group, a global leader in research.
Purpose of the Role
Ensure efficient, compliant, and reliable supply chain operations across warehouse and distribution processes. Apply specialist-level knowledge, work independently, and contribute to the development and implementation of improved standards, processes, and workflows across the site.
Key Accountabilities
- Execute warehouse operations including goods receipt, storage, internal provisioning (milk run), and inventory tasks such as cycle counts, ensuring accuracy, compliance, and smooth material flows.
- Perform distribution activities including packing, documentation, shipping, and import/export processing, ensuring adherence to regulatory requirements and internal standards.
- Work closely with Global material planning to ensure right inventory levels.
- Apply specialist understanding of pharmaceutical materials (consumables, chemicals, biomaterials) to ensure safe, compliant, and efficient handling.
- Utilize logistics tools and ERP/WMS systems with expertise; ensure accurate documentation, traceability, and data integrity.
- Independently implement (sub)projects focused on process optimization, systemic introduction of standards, and lean improvements.
- Communicate effectively with cross-functional stakeholders (e.g., Quality, Labs, Manufacturing, EHS, Supply Chain) to coordinate workflows and resolve operational topics.
- Train colleagues in specific workflows and support capability building within the team.
